Common Deficiency Symptoms Common symptoms of Vitamin B12 deficiency include: Fatigue Weakness Pale skin Shortness Mouth Issues: Sore, red tongue, mouth ulcers, bleeding gums Gastrointestinal: Loss of appetite, weight loss, nausea, diarrhea, constipation Nerve issues like numbness/tingling Mood changes (depression, irritability) Memory problems Key Differences: NAD+ vs B12 NAD+ and B12 both boost energy, but NAD+ acts as a deep cellular, anti-aging repair agent, while B12 provides immediate metabolic energy and red blood cell support
